Communication is interaction and is very important in business – perhaps more so than anywhere else. Communication is the thing that ensures smooth operation between the team, employers and clients. Employers will need to use their communication skills in order to get the very best out of their employees. Employees need to use communication skills when talking to clients as well as colleagues and employers. Communication doesn’t always refer to conversation. There are many ways in which you will need to communicate whilst at work. Written communication is often forgotten about when applying for a job. Your CV, for example, is a form of communication. This is why it is so important that it is well written and grammatically correct. At some point when working in an office environment, you will most likely have to write emails and/or letters. You should ensure that these always look and sound professional. Take your time with these sorts of tasks as the finished articles will be a direct refection on your writing skills and grammatical accuracy. In order for companies to succeed, communication between them and their clients has to be perfect. To ensure that business continues to flow, a company’s clients have to be able to trust them implicitly. This can never be the case if there is any miscommunication. Clients will feel unsafe if they are receiving contradictory information from more than once source. Many companies decide that is a good idea to hire a ‘Head of Communication’. This person will be the sole point of contact for all clients. This removes any opportunity for misunderstanding as all communication runs through one person. In conclusion, communication in the workplace is a key element of any company.
